“Everyone Can Be a Good Samaritan”

Those were the words of the Pope Leo XIV in his message for world’s sick. To love one’s neighbor — whom Jesus identifies as anyone who has need of us — is within everyone’s reach, the pope said in his message for the 34th World Day of the Sick, to be observed by the church Feb. 11, the feast of Our Lady of Lourdes.
